**Mgmt Meeting Minutes — Retiring the Brightline Range**

Quick recap for sales leads at Fenholt Supplies: we agreed to retire the Brightline fixture range by year-end. Remaining stock moves to clearance pricing next month, and accounts on standing orders get migrated to the Lumetta range. Trade-in incentives were approved in principle. The confidential note on next steps sits just below.

board note of bajof-bajeg: The pricing group signed off on a budget of $13.4 million for Project Sildor. The renewal with Lamixek Holdings closes at $48.9 million a year, 49 percent above the last contract.

Test-plan note — Stale-cache postmortem (Willowgate incident)

Verify that the Corvid cache layer now respects the shortened TTL on profile reads, and that invalidation messages from the Hatchling queue arrive within two seconds. Support should reproduce the original stale-read scenario on staging before sign-off. To replay recorded invalidation traffic against staging, authenticate using the token below.

session JWT of yawep-yawep = eyJhbGciOiJIUzI1NiIsInR5cCI6IkpXVCJ9.eyJzdWIiOiI3pWF3_In0.aXYsHiog

## Key Ceremony Checklist — Item 7

Owner: Renderers team (Inkmarsh pipeline). New folks: the markdown rendering pipeline signs its output bundles. During the quarterly key ceremony, rotate the signing key before the parser upgrade lands. Verify: two witnesses present, HSM sled powered, old key revoked in the Lanternfall registry, test document renders clean. If rotation fails mid-ceremony, do not retry; restore from the sealed backup instead. Unsealing that backup requires the recovery passphrase recorded below.

vault phrase of tajop-haduf = holath-brivan-wenax

Key ceremony checklist — item 6 of 9. System: Quorra alert deduplicator. Confirm both keyholders present; verify the dedup signing key fingerprint against the Hallix ledger printout. Rotate the suppression-rule signing key, re-sign the active rule bundle, and verify alerts still collapse correctly in staging. Future maintainers: record timestamps in the ceremony log before sealing. If the ceremony vault rejects the new key, fall back to manual unlock with the passphrase below.

recovery phrase for fajep-yaweg: gilath-sorox-wenius-rusdor-keliel-zorius